Where to Be Cautious

While My Favorite RN Nurse Calls Me Yaya is a solid design, there are some situations where it might not perform as well. If you’re working with small hoop sizes, the design may require multiple hooping steps, which can be time-consuming. Similarly, on textured or stretchy fabrics, the stitch density might cause puckering or distortion if not stabilized properly.

Thin or dark fabrics could also pose challenges. The design’s detail might not show up as clearly on darker backgrounds, so testing with different thread colors is essential. Tiny lettering or decorative accents might get lost if the stitch density is too low, so adjusting the settings for clarity is important.
